Cornell Professor to Deliver Free Lecture on China

Dear CAFAM members,

Allen Carlson, an international relations expert from Cornell University, will deliver a lecture titled “Contemporary China: Dragon or Panda” on November 21 from 3:15 PM-5 PM in Garland Auditorium on Thornton Academy’s campus at 438 Main Street in Saco. The event is free and open to the public, sponsored by Thornton Academy and York County Senior College (YCSC).

Allen Carlson is an Associate Professor in Cornell University’s Government Department. He earned a PhD from Yale University’s Political Science Department and an undergraduate degree from Colby College. He serves as Director of Cornell’s China Asia Pacific Studies Program and is currently working on a project exploring the issue of nontraditional security in China’s emerging relationship with the rest of the international system.

Thornton Academy, whose mission is to “prepare students for a changing world” welcomes students from 35 countries around the globe, including China. Seven foreign language courses are offered to students, including four levels of Honors Chinese, as well as AP Chinese, and an after-school Chinese Club provides fun opportunities to practice conversational Chinese and learn about Chinese culture.

York County Senior College provides lifelong learning opportunities and the chance for seniors to interact with their peers, both in and out of the classroom. Affiliated with the University of Maine system, YCSC is run by a governing council of volunteers.
